## Runbook: Connection Pool Changes

Plugin authors integrating with the Ostermill data layer: release 7.1 caps per-plugin pool size at twelve connections and enforces a two-second acquisition timeout. Audit your plugins for long-held connections and release them promptly, or requests will queue and time out. After updating, run the pool stress check in the sandbox. Signed plugin packages only — sign your archive with the key below.

release key, fafof-hawip: bky6_52YEwQ

Management Meeting Minutes — Project Larkspur Delay

Attendees: department heads. The Larkspur platform migration is now nine weeks behind schedule due to vendor integration issues flagged by the Telfort team. Testing resources will be reassigned from the Orenby rollout to recover four weeks. Budget impact is within contingency. Heads are asked to brief their teams on revised dates only. The confidential note on downstream business plans appears below.

management briefing: Istaelix Group is in early talks to buy Sorysax Logistics for about $496.2 million. The Kasox launch date is October 3, and nothing goes to the press before then. Legal wants the Norokax Foods term sheet withdrawn before April 25.

**Vendor note: Inkmill markdown pipeline**

Rendering for Parchway docs is outsourced to Inkmill under an annual contract, renewing each March. They handle sanitization and PDF export; we own the upload queue. SLA: 4-hour response on rendering failures. Escalate only after two failed retries. Their support desk is reachable at the address below.

billing contact of hahaf-baguf = zorael.tammir.jorius@sivrelhq.internal

Break-glass: Replica lag alarm (Durnfeld cluster). Alarm fires when read-replica lag exceeds 45s for 3 consecutive checks. Break-glass grants write access to the replication controller for 30 minutes, fully audited. Reviewers: confirm the requester filed an incident first. The break-glass console rejects SSO during a lag storm by design; it accepts only the standing recovery passphrase, noted directly below this line.

strongbox words: istwyn-normir-silwyn-ulaius-istwyn